How to Calculate Water Tank Pump Capacity for Your Home

Sizing a pump to fill your overhead tank correctly means it fills in a reasonable time without wasting energy or cycling constantly. This guide shows the simple calculation with real examples.

1. The Two Numbers You Need

  • Flow rate: How fast the pump moves water (litres per minute)
  • Head: How high it must lift the water (metres)

2. Calculate Required Flow Rate

Decide how quickly you want the tank filled. Flow rate = Tank capacity ÷ Desired fill time. Example: a 1,000-litre tank you want filled in 20 minutes needs 50 litres/minute.

3. Calculate Head

Head = height from the pump/sump water level to the tank inlet + pipe friction + safety margin. For a typical 2-storey home: about 8m lift + 2m friction = 10m head.

4. Worked Example

1,000L tank, fill in 20 min (50 LPM), 2-storey home (10m head). A 1 HP monoblock or 1 HP submersible comfortably delivers 50+ LPM at 10m — the right choice.

5. Avoid These Mistakes

  • Oversizing so the tank fills in 5 minutes — the pump short-cycles and wears out
  • Undersizing the delivery pipe — chokes the flow regardless of pump size
  • Ignoring head — a high-flow pump with low head rating will not reach an upper tank
